The American Red Cross encourages donors to boost their impact by giving blood or platelets this November. The last two months of the year can be challenging for many donors trying to balance regular donation appointments with busy schedules filled with seasonal activities and holiday plans. Donors of all blood types − especially those with types O negative, O positive, and B negative blood, as well as platelet donors − are urged to schedule an appointment to donate now.

The Red Cross is experiencing a decline in donor turnout this fall – a crucial time for scheduling and maintaining appointments to ensure enough lifesaving blood supplies for the holidays. More donors are needed to keep the blood supply stable. To motivate and inform our donors, in November, successful blood donations will include free A1C testing, commonly used to screen for prediabetes and diabetes. (One test result per 12-month period; fasting is not required before donating). Visit RedCrossBlood.org/diabetes for more details.
